Benefits of Joining a Weight Loss Clinic



If you're aiming to drop weight and remain motivated, signing up with a weight loss clinic can provide you many advantages. Among the main advantages is the assistance and support you receive from experts that specialize in weight-loss. They can produce a tailored strategy customized to your specific needs and objectives, assisting you make much healthier food options and establish an exercise regimen that benefits you.

In addition, becoming part of a weight loss clinic supplies a feeling of area and liability. You can connect with others that are on the same trip as you, sharing experiences, difficulties, and triumphes. This support group can keep you encouraged and influenced, particularly throughout tough times.

Additionally, weight loss clinics often use instructional sources, workshops, and seminars to aid you gain understanding concerning proper nourishment, part control, and lasting way of life adjustments.

Downsides of Signing Up With a Weight Loss Clinic



While there are numerous benefits to signing up with a weight loss clinic, there are also some disadvantages to take into consideration.

One more drawback is the moment dedication. Participating in routine appointments and adhering to the clinic's program can take up a significant amount of your time, which might be difficult to take care of if you have a busy schedule.

Furthermore, some individuals may find the strict regulations and guidelines of a weight loss clinic to be also limiting or challenging to adhere to.

It's important to evaluate these downsides against the possible benefits prior to determining to sign up with a weight loss clinic.
